Brett Favre Backtracks His Remarks Comparing Colin Kaepernick and Pat Tillman

On Monday evening Brett Favre decided it was time to walk back the comments he made during an interview with TMZ Sports comparing Colin Kaepernick and Pat Tillman.

Faver said his comments were not made to compare the two, “but a recognition that they both sidelined their football dreams in pursuit of a cause.”

He did make it clear that Tillman, killed in 2004 by friendly fire in Afghanistan, made the “ultimate sacrifice, and deserve the honest honor.”

“I can only think of right off the top of my head, Pat Tillman is another guy that did something similar,” Favre told TMZ Sports on Saturday. “And, we regard him as a hero. So, I’d assume that hero status will be stamped with Kaepernick as well.”
